Now in its 19th year, the Decanter World Wine Awards (DWWA) is the world’s largest and most influential wine competition, with unrivaled global reach. Judged by top wine experts from around the globe, DWWA is trusted internationally for its rigorous judging process.  It aims at selecting the products which best represent their style and terroir throughout the globe.

 

Within the category of wines from the New World, along with those from New Zealand, Chile, Canada, South Africa and Australia, Argentine wines have been exceptionally well represented this year, with superb results, and a total of 41 medals.

 

As part of the rigorous judging process, in this 19th edition, almost 250 expert judges, including 41 Masters of Wine and 13 Master Sommeliers, evaluated 18,244 wines from 54 countries at DWWA 2022, making it a record year for wines tasted, which concluded with a selection of the best exponents.

 

Great scores for our malbecs

Our wines have achieved an outstanding performance in this contest, obtaining high scores within the different lines of the Rutini portfolio:

 

Single Vineyard Altamira Malbec 2019

97 points

Made entirely with Malbec grapes from our Altamira vineyard, 80% of this wine is aged for 12 months in French oak barrels.  It has an aging potential of 15 years.

In Altamira, these vines produce low yields.  When the grapes are ripe, a great aromatic concentration is obtained, highlighting floral aromas on the nose with a predominance of violets and lavender, and a particular aniseed character.  These notes are combined with others of cocoa and toast provided by the wine’s aging in oak.  On the palate, it is firm with round tannins. It has a fresh and persistent finish.

 

Single Vineyard Gualtallary Malbec 2019

95 points

Made with 100% Malbec grapes from Gualtallary, 50% of this wine is aged for 12 months in French oak barrels.  It has an aging potential of 15 years.

It is a lively purple wine, with dense garnet reflections. Very aromatic, it surprises us with its intense floral and fruity aromas, reminiscent of violets, cherries, plums, and blueberries.  It is broad on the palate, where it displays a unique expression of both the Malbec grape, as well as from the terroir where it was born.  The red fruits and berries, as well as the spices (pepper, vanilla), are enhanced by the wine’s aging in oak, which brings about accents of cocoa and tobacco. In the aftertaste, a fleeting astringency and bright acidity guarantee a long aging potential.

 

Rutini Dominio Malbec 2020

95 points

Made with 100% Malbec grapes from La Consulta, 20% of the wine is aged for 12 months in French oak barrels.  It has an aging potential of 10 years.

It is a limpid garnet red, portraying violet reflections. On the nose, fruity aromas such as plum, floral aromas such as violet, and a spicy touch of licorice stand out.  In the mouth, the typicity of the varietal is granted through flavors of black fruits.  It is a juicy and fresh wine, with balanced acidity.

 

Apartado Gran Malbec 2019

94 points

This is a blend of Malbecs from our different vineyards, made with 40% Malbec from Gualtallary, 40% Malbec from Altamira, and 20% Malbec from La Consulta.  It has been aged for 18 months in French oak barrels, and has 15 years of aging potential.

It is an intense red wine with dazzling violet reflections. On the nose, it is complex and elegant, with very diverse floral and fruit notes, along with subtle aniseed. On the palate, it is a highly concentrated wine, very long and complex.  It is fruit-forward and powerful; these aspects being complemented by some of the La Consulta terroir’s characteristics, such as licorice.  It has notes of cocoa and coffee, provided by the medium toasting of the barrel, which are very pleasant. It is a grand Malbec, with a lengthy, polished finish.

 

Rutini Colección Cabernet Franc/Malbec 2020

93 points

This is a blend of 50% Cabernet Franc and 50% Malbec.  10% of the wine is aged for 12 months in French oak barrels.  It has an aging potential of 6 years.

It is a lively violet color, with ruby ​​highlights. On the nose, it showcases spicy aromas of saffron, curry, and smoke. Menthol, cooked tomato, and fresh oregano are also notes which emerge. On the palate, it is a round wine, where the fruity flavors of plum and cassis stand out.  Its well-achieved acidity provides a lively freshness.
